How eSIM Works

An eSIM, or embedded SIM, allows you to connect to a mobile network without having to insert a physical SIM card into your device. Instead, the eSIM is programmed via a QR code or an app, making it easy to switch networks and plans as you travel across the country.

eSIM vs Roaming

Using an eSIM can save you a considerable amount compared to international roaming charges. Roaming fees can be exorbitant, while eSIM data plans often provide better rates and flexibility for travelers.

Traveler Connectivity Mistakes

To avoid connectivity issues, travelers often make the mistake of not setting up their eSIM before arrival. Make sure to download and install your eSIM plan before traveling. Additionally, do not forget to monitor your data usage, especially if you opt for a limited plan.

FAQ

Can I use my existing mobile number with eSIM?

Yes, many eSIM providers allow you to retain your existing mobile number while using the eSIM for data.

Is eSIM available for all phone models?

No, eSIM compatibility depends on your device. Ensure your phone supports eSIM before purchasing a plan.

How do I deactivate my eSIM?

You can deactivate your eSIM through your device settings, depending on your phone model.
